Hi, I am Natalia
"I went from founding a company in the interior of Buenos Aires to championing more than 400,000 SMEs across the region. Today I share that real-world learning so your business can scale too."
More than 19 years ago I founded LUDMARC SRL in Mercedes, 100 km from Buenos Aires: a wholesale food distribution company, bakery and online supermarket that keeps growing, innovating and professionalizing.
That business led me into trade-association leadership. Today I am President of Women Entrepreneurs at the Buenos Aires Economic Federation (FEBA), Associate Secretary of Women Entrepreneurs at the Argentine Confederation of Medium-Sized Business (CAME) and Vice President of the Women Business Convergence (CEMS).
Representing Argentina at the B20 in India, Brazil and South Africa, being chosen Community Leader for Latin America and the Caribbean at UNCTAD eTrade for Women, and joining Santander W50 at the London School of Economics confirmed something I had been building from Mercedes. When there is purpose, there is a path. Where you start does not limit where you go.
Education: BA in Public and Institutional Relations, UADE (Honors) · MBA, National University of Luján · Santander W50, London School of Economics · Global Women Leadership, Georgetown University · Diversity & Inclusion, ESSEC Business School · Goldman Sachs 10,000 Women · ILO · Languages: Spanish · English (C1) · Portuguese (B1) · German (B1)
